#dfe100 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#dfe100 is composed of 87.5% red, 88.2%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 100% yellow and 11.8% black. It has a hue angle of 60.5 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 44.1%. #dfe100 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ff00 with #bfc300. Closest websafe color is: #cccc00.

#dfe100 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#dfe100 has RGB values of R:223, G:225,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0.01, M:0, Y:1, K:0.12. Its decimal value is 14672128.

Shades and Tints of #dfe100
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090900 is the darkest color, while #fffff5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#dfe100
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#797968 is the less saturated color, while #dfe100 is the most saturated one.
